Marsha Ginsberg Biography
  Born in New York City
  Lives and work in New York City
  New York University, Tisch School of the Arts, New York, NY
  Master of Fine Arts in Theater Design
  Whitney Museum of American Art, Independent Study Studio Program, New York, NY
  Cooper Union for the Advancement of Science and Art, School of Art, New York, NY
  Bachelor of Fine Arts
Selected Exhibitions
2009   Design for Don Pasquale by Donizetti, directed by Roy Rallo, National Theater Weimar, Germany
2009   Scenic design for Telephone, a new play by poet Ariana Reines. Telephone operates like a switchboard connecting Watson and Bell, a succession of cellphone calls between people who love each other, and a famous schizophrenic. Directed by Ken Schmoll, Foundry Theater Company, at the Cherry Lane Theater, New York City
2008   Design Life Now, National Design Triennial, Contemporary Museum, Houston, TX
2007   Design Life Now, National Design Triennial, ICA Boston
2007   Artforum, Berlin, Magnus M�ller Gallery
2007   Pulse, London, Magnus M�ller Gallery
2007   Pulse, Miami, Magnus M�ller Gallery
2007   Pavlov's Lab and Other Rooms, Magnus M�ller Gallery, Berlin (solo)
2007   Photographs and stage-construction (solo)
2007   Curated performance series within installation: performances by directors Norma Somaini, David Levine, Heiko Kalmbach (solo)
2006   Design Life Now, National Design Triennial, Cooper Hewitt Museum, NYC
1999   Holiday Inn, Fine Arts Work Center, Provincetown, MA
1999   Turning Point 101, Pacific Design Center, Los Angeles, CA
1998   New Blood 101, Pacific Design Center, Los Angeles; AIA, San Francisco; Yale University, Art & Architecture Gallery
1997   The Register, A multi-media installation in several rooms of an abandoned Victorian Hotel, Art Awareness, Lexington, NY (Collaborators: Geoff Korf, lights; Wayne Frost, sound score; Peter Mattei, playwright) (solo)
